Gang Resistance
Education And Training
is an anti-gang and violence program designed to help elementary and
middle school students become responsible members of their community by
setting goals for themselves, resisting peer pressure, learning how to
resolve conflicts, and understanding how gangs impact the quality of
their lives. Principals, school administrators and teachers who are
interested in the program should contact the Community Service Office
